Ghanshyam Sahu, a resident of Uparwara of Durg, sold two acres of land to invest the proceeds in a chit fund company, only to realise he had been duped. Like hundreds others, Sahu had given up hope of getting the money back. So when he received Rs 9 lakh from the state government last month, he couldn't believe his luck. "I did not expect the money to be recovered," he candidly told Chhattisgarh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el at an event in January.
